I will find out Monday from HWH. Remember, when items are installed they are installed because THEY ARE deemed necessary. I have never had a problem remounting the cross braces on HWH jacks. I think they are there to keep each jack from having to support each side completely with twisting. You will notice HWH straight jacks pivot side to side and I believe they use the cross brace to keep the system as rigid as possible. MY best guess would be they extended the jacks without the cross brace installed and that slightly bent the mount plate for the cross brace. Should not be a big problem to jack the brace up and use a pry bar to get the alignment and bolts back in. Doug
